  • It'd be cheaper to get your degree via CLEP, DANTES and GRE Subject tests and get a degree from Excelsior College, Charter Oak State College or Thomas Edison State College, the only three regionally accredited schools that don't have a residency requirement (meaning you can take one class from them and graduate coupled with credits from anywhere else that's regionally accredited)

    It's the only reason I finally got a degree after coupling credits from 4 years in the Air Force and 3 years of undergraduate work @ 3 schools. It would've been cheaper had I done it entirely that way and probably less than $7000.
